云安全中的编译优化与性能实战
|
在云安全领域,编译优化正逐渐成为提升系统防护能力的关键技术。通过在代码生成阶段引入安全相关的指令重排与冗余消除,编译器能够有效降低潜在漏洞的可利用性。例如,对敏感数据访问路径进行静态分析后,编译器可自动插入访问控制检查,使攻击者难以通过内存泄漏或缓冲区溢出获取关键信息。 性能与安全并非对立关系。现代编译优化工具链如LLVM已支持细粒度的安全增强选项,可在不显著影响执行效率的前提下,嵌入运行时保护机制。例如,通过启用栈保护(Stack Canary)和地址空间布局随机化(ASLR)的编译标记,系统在启动时即可获得更强的抗攻击能力,而代码执行开销通常控制在5%以内。
2026AI模拟图,仅供参考 在实际部署中,云环境的动态特性要求编译优化具备自适应能力。针对不同负载场景,可采用基于反馈的优化策略——即根据运行时行为收集数据,动态调整代码结构。这种“运行时感知”的编译方式,既能保证核心服务的低延迟响应,又能持续强化安全防御层级。 容器化与微服务架构的普及推动了轻量级编译优化的需求。通过预编译安全加固镜像,开发团队可在部署前完成大部分安全检查,减少运行时风险。同时,结合CI/CD流水线中的自动化检测,确保每一次更新都经过安全与性能双重验证。 综合来看,编译优化不仅是提升代码效率的手段,更是构建纵深防御体系的重要一环。当安全意识融入编译流程,云应用便能在高效运行的同时,构筑起更坚固的防线。未来,随着AI辅助编译技术的发展,安全与性能的平衡将更加智能、精准。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

